AFPF's Challenge

In August, 2007 AFPF received a $25,000 grant from the Challenge Fund for Journalism – a consortium of the Ethics and Excellence in Journalism Foundation, Ford Foundation, James L. and John S. Knight Foundation and McCormick-Tribune Foundation. The goal is to raise, at a minimum, an additional $25,000 in new or increased donations from our individual supporters. Because donations will be matched 100 percent, this is an amazing opportunity for AFPF to raise at least $50,000 to support the program and its growth.

What is the purpose of the Challenge?

To help journalism organizations improve their long-term financial health and sustainability by cultivating support from more individual donors.

What plans does AFPF have for the grant period?

Your contributions and this grant will allow us to reshape our governance and our finances, to infuse new ideas and energy into the Foundation and Fellowships. We expect to restructure the board of our primary funder, the recently renamed Alfred and Jean Friendly Foundation, so that it will have a majority of members who are not Friendlys. We believe the family has been good stewards of the program and have taken many steps to make it more relevant to journalism today. Click here for more about our current work] We want to continue that forward motion with new board members who will help us raise the funds that will make us less dependent on year-to-year grants. Two Friendly family members will remain on the Foundation board, but we'll be able to tap the expertise of a broader range of people who know and admire the program and whose professional connections will assure that we continue to be relevant and effective.

How was AFPF selected for this Challenge?

Current grantees of these four foundations were invited to apply for the grant. Twelve organizations were selected from an application pool of 23.

What is the time frame of the Challenge?

Exactly one year. Donations received between August 9, 2007 and August 8, 2008 are eligible for the 100 percent match.

How much money must AFPF raise?

AFPF has already received the $25,000 from CFJ. We must now raise $25,000 from individuals.

What kinds of individual donations will qualify toward fulfillment of the Challenge?

Contributions from NEW individual donors, including spouses and significant others of past donors.

New contributions from past donors will count, at least in part:

- For donors who have not contributed more recently than August 8, 2004, the entire amount of the any new gift will count.

- For past donors who have contributed since August 9, 2004, only the amount of increase over the highest, single prior donation since August 9, 2004, will count toward the Challenge.
